For the sixth oil painting in my classic RPG series, I painted another scene from Chrono Trigger, this time featuring Magus and Schala in Zeal Palace. The Zeal plotline in Chrono Trigger is one of my favorite parts of the game, following Magus' journey through time and his search for his sister. You could argue that Schala's role and Magus' journey are central to the entire story, shaping events and connecting time periods. I felt like this would be a great scene to attempt, but a challenging one. Trying to capture the right emotional tone was definitely at the front of my mind when trying to figure out the composition.

My latest classic game inspired painting features a couple of characters from Final Fantasy IV, Rydia and Ceil, sitting with a chocobo nearby. I've done a couple now from the Final Fantasy series already, so it felt like a must to get into this one. I talked about how much of a game-changer Final Fantasy VI's story was, but really I think Final Fantasy IV was the first game I recall that provided this sort of complex, movie-like plot. This piece was a bit tricky to conceptualize though, as I always preferred Cecil's dark knight design to his paladin change in the second half of the game. I did try to capture the vibe of some of the forested areas of the game, and definitely enjoyed painting the chocobo peeking around the corner.

Concerned Man with Ocean Village Landscape - Art print of an oil painting. I had originally hoped to create a scene with several people in front of an oceanside village. As I started working in the underpainting, I realized I didn't really have space for additional people if I wanted any of the landscape to be visible. I was on a scenic ocean overlook kick at the time, so I didn't want to sacrifice that aspect. But I was able to add one additional person sort of off to the side. I wasn't sure if this would unbalance the piece too badly, but I was hopeful the shape of the bay would focus the gaze towards the right a bit. I like this piece quite a bit and actually framed and hung up the original.
